One tablespoon (8g) of olives (in brine) provides: 9Kcal/35KJ. 0.1g Protein. 0.9g Fat. 0.3g Fibre. 8mg Potassium. 5mg Calcium. Olives are typically high in salt due to the fact that they are cured or packaged in brine or salt water, containing about 0.6g salt per five olives.

Search for crossword clues found in the Daily Celebrity, NY Times, Daily Mirror, Telegraph and … Web4 May 2010 · Olives are great at "surviving", but if you want them to look good you need to feed regularly, during the growing season, if pot grown. Any balanced liquid feed will be OK, such as 'miracle grow' or similar, but dont feed for a few weeks after repotting, let the roots start to move into the new compost first. pete, May 1, 2010 sv veeravalli
